Soft Ferrites - the magnetic material for high frequency technology
Based on decades of experience producing ferrites, Tridelta currently develops and manufactures high-quality material in a variety of different forms.
Soft ferrites are used in a wide range of different fields: • as core material in coils and transformers in power
electronics, (e.g. line output transformers, memory chokes,
logic systems components, chokes)
• for anti interference devices
• in filter coils and impulse transformers and numerous other individual uses.
Magnetic components manufactured by Tridelta from manganese-zinc-ferrite bear the trademark Manifer®. The saturation induction of Manifer material lies between 400 and 500 mT (4000 - 5000 Gauss), thus making power transmission in the kilowatt range possible. Manifer is characterised by low electrical conductivity and is therefore especially suitable for high-frequency applications.
